Summary

Overview

In 2024, Hajipur averaged an AQI of 173 while Munger averaged 130 — a 43-point (33%) gap, with Hajipur the more polluted and Munger the cleaner of the two. On 913 days when both cities reported, Hajipur was cleaner on 497 of them; the average daily gap was 64 AQI points.

Seasonality & days

Hajipur peaks in December, while Munger peaks in January. Hajipur logged 0.3% Severe days and 36.6% Good-or-Satisfactory days; Munger was 1.5% Severe and 22.9% Good-or-Satisfactory. Longest clean-air streaks: Hajipur 36 days, Munger 12 days.

Year-over-year progress

Hajipur has worsened by 74 AQI points (74.7%) from 2020 to 2024; Munger has improved by 135 AQI points (50.9%) over the same window. The worst recorded day for Hajipur reached AQI 427 at Industrial Area (BSPCB) on 2024-11-12; Munger hit AQI 445 at Town Hall (BSPCB) on 2022-01-06.
